
Power Home Remodeling is an American corporation headquartered in Chester, Pennsylvania. This company specializes providing exterior remodeling products that save money and energy. These include vinyl siding, roofing and replacement windows. Their goal is to help customers save money and the environment on home improvements. Power offers many energy efficient features when it comes to residential roofing. The frames are filled with polyurethane foam and have fusion-welded corners. They also offer ultra-efficient Low E glass with Heat Shield. Vinyl spacers are included in their windows to reduce energy transfer. They also offer award-winning customer support and installation. All of their work comes with a comprehensive warranty. This guarantees you the best possible results.

How can I avoid being ripped off while renovating my home?
The best way to avoid being ripped off is to know what you are paying for. Before signing any contract, read through the fine print carefully. Don't sign any contracts that aren't complete. Always ask for copies of signed contracts.

How do I choose a good contractor?
Ask family and friends to recommend contractors. Online reviews are also a good option. Check to make sure the contractor has experience with the type of construction you are looking for. Get references from other people and review them.

Statistics
- On jumbo loans of more than $636,150, you'll be able to borrow up to 80% of the home's completed value. (kiplinger.com)
- A final payment of, say, 5% to 10% will be due when the space is livable and usable (your contract probably will say "substantial completion"). (kiplinger.com)
- The average fixed rate for a home-equity loan was recently 5.27%, and the average variable rate for a HELOC was 5.49%, according to Bankrate.com. (kiplinger.com)
- It is advisable, however, to have a contingency of 10–20 per cent to allow for the unexpected expenses that can arise when renovating older homes. (realhomes.com)
- According to the National Association of the Remodeling Industry's 2019 remodeling impact report , realtors estimate that homeowners can recover 59% of the cost of a complete kitchen renovation if they sell their home. (bhg.com)

How to Renovate an Old House?
Before you start, it is essential that you decide which type of renovation project to undertake. This could range from simple updates to your kitchen appliances, to completely changing the look of the entire house.
Once you decide what kind of renovations you want, you will need to calculate how much money is available. You may find that your funds are not sufficient to cover the whole project. If this is the case, then you need to make some tough decisions about which areas of the house you can afford to improve and which ones you can't.
There are many things to remember before you begin work if you have decided to do renovations. It is important to get all permits necessary for your job. You might also need to check whether you need planning permission for certain types or work. You might have to apply for building permission if you want to add an extension to your home.
Before you start working on the house, it's always best to check the local council website to see if they require any additional permits.
